Translated loosely from Japanese, uradoori no nukemichi means "back alley shortcut," while ane harem refers to an older sister or mature woman harem dynamic. Together, these terms represent a distinct flavor of adult entertainment and lifestyle fantasy: finding a hidden, comforting refuge away from the mainstream world, guided by mature, supportive figures. Unlike standard high school harem setups where characters are peers, the inclusion of the ane (older sister/mature figure) archetype shifts the power dynamic. The protagonist is frequently depicted as younger, less experienced, or passive, while the female characters take on more assertive roles. The subversion of traditional roles—where the love interests drive the progression of the relationship—is a core selling point for audiences seeking this specific dynamic. The "back alley shortcut" ( uradoori no nukemichi ) functions as a critical narrative device. Instead of a sweeping fantasy world, the story is usually grounded in a recognizable, gritty, or mundane modern Japanese city. The alleyway serves as a transitional space—a boundary between normal daily life (school or work) and a hidden world of romance or drama. This setting allows creators to introduce chance encounters that disrupt the protagonist's ordinary routine. Character Dynamics: The Mature Harem
